Checking and securing understanding of area for standard shapes

2D and 3D shape: compound shapes

Unit Summary

In this unit, knowledge of circles and polygons is drawn upon to find the arc length and area of a circle sector and areas of complex compound shapes.

Lesson Summary

You will learn to calculate the area of rectangles, triangles, parallelograms and trapeziums efficiently.

Key Notes

  • The formula for the area of a rectangle is bh
  • The formula for the area of a parallelogram is bh
  • The formula for the area of a triangle is bh ÷ 2
  • The formula for the area of a trapezium is ((a+b)h) ÷ 2

Vocabulary To Learn

  • Area: The area is the size of the surface and states the number of unit squares needed to completely cover that surface.
  • Trapezium: A trapezium is a quadrilateral with exactly one pair of parallel opposite sides. The plural of trapezium can be referred to as trapezia or trapeziums.

Common Mistakes To Avoid

  • Pupils might find the area of parallelograms and triangles by multiplying the length of two adjacent edges which are not perpendicular.

3. Spot and fix this common maths mistake.

Mistake: Pupils might find the area of parallelograms and triangles by multiplying the length of two adjacent edges which are not perpendicular. Correction: Calculating the area of a shape involves multiplying two perpendicular lengths. These may not be horizontal and vertical in the shape's initial orientation.
